What is Dissipative Epoxy Flooring?
Dissipative epoxy flooring is an electrostatic discharge (ESD) flooring system that gradually dissipates static electricity instead of instantly conducting it. It is widely used in facilities handling sensitive electronic equipment where controlled static dissipation is essential.

Technical Specifications
Typical characteristics of dissipative epoxy flooring systems. Final specifications depend on project requirements.
Electrical Resistance
10⁶–10⁹ Ω
Controlled static dissipation suitable for ESD-sensitive environments.
System Thickness
2–3 mm
Standard application thickness for industrial floors.

It is an ESD flooring system designed to slowly dissipate electrostatic charges, protecting sensitive equipment from static damage.
Conductive flooring transfers electrical charges more rapidly, while dissipative flooring controls the discharge at a slower, safer rate suitable for many industrial applications.
